Moise Kean has been fined €2,000 for diving against Cagliari, who will be investigated after their fans racially abused the Juventus striker.
The FIGC ruled on Thursday that a second investigation would be needed to identify the individuals who subjected Kean to racist chants at the Sardegna Arena midweek.
In the meantime, however, the Italy starlet must pay €2,000 for his act of simulation during the Bianconeri’s 2-0 win.
Napoli hitman Arkadiusz Milik is also fined €2,000 for diving during Napoli’s 2-1 defeat to Empoli.
Elsewhere, one-match bans have been handed out to Genoa pair Cristian Romero and Ervin Zukanovic, Sampdoria’s Bartosz Bereszynski, SPAL’s Manuel Lazzari, Torino’s Sasa Lukic and Cagliari’s Darijo Srna.
Inter are fined €12,000 for discriminatory chanting towards Genoa fans, while Lazio sporting director Igli Tare is ordered to pay €5,000 for criticising the VAR following his club’s 1-0 loss to SPAL.
Finally, SPAL boss Leonardo Semplici is hit with the same punishment as Tare, albeit for kicking a water bottle in response to a refereeing decision.
